Official abstract text for this publication.
A water-resistant gypsum fiber product comprising siloxane and coated with a coating comprising alkali metal organosiliconate is provided. A method of making a gypsum fiber product in which siloxane is cross-linked at the surface of the product is also provided. A fuel-efficient method for making the product and reducing the amount of siloxane dust released is provided as well.
Opening claim text (preview).
What is claimed is: 1. A method for decreasing the amount of siloxane dust generated in a kiln, the method comprising: preparing a gypsum slurry comprising calcium sulfate dihydrate; heating the slurry under pressure to calcine the calcium sulfate dihydrate to form alpha-calcined calcium sulfate hemihydrate; relieving the pressure; after the step of calcining under pressure has been completed and the pressure has been relieved, adding a siloxane dispersion to the slurry; dewatering the slurry to form a filter cake; forming the cake into a desired shape; allowing the cake to set to form a product; coating the product with a coating comprising alkali metal organosiliconate; placing the coated product in the kiln; and thereby decreasing the amount of siloxane dust generated in a kiln. 2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the alkali metal organosiliconate is potassium methyl siliconate. 3. The method of claim 1 , wherein the siloxane is methylhydrogensiloxane. 4. The method of claim 1 , wherein the siloxane is used in amounts of about 0.08% to about 1.0% by weight of the total amount of gypsum. 5. The method of claim 1 , wherein the alkali metal organosiliconate is used in the amount from 0.1% to 10% by weight of the coating and from 0.002% to 2% by weight of the total amount of gypsum.
